Actually most JDM pull outs are usually in good shape. Japanese replace engines far more often then we do, in fact back in the day with timing belt changes required I remember a Japanese buddy that worked for my company telling me that they just "replaced the motor" instead of paying the labor to do timing belt changes.

Still while you have it out of the car I would check and freshen up anything that is wearable. The value cover gasgets are probably toast, pulling the heads off should give you a good idea of what your dealing with, but I'll bet you it is in good shape.

It's coming with a 90 day warranty but I hope it is in good shape. The seller claims it has 45k on it. I found a post by q45 tech and have started a list of changes that I'll do while its out: hoses, belts, injectors, water pump, motor mounts?, front and rear main seals?, and check for timing chain guides.
